Professional Bio

Yolanda graduated with a Master of Physical Therapy degree from the Medical College of Georgia in 2004. Her bachelor’s degrees are in Exercise Science and Psychology. She is a 500-Hour Certified Pilates Instructor and Master Water Fitness Instructor. As a physical therapist for over 20 years, she has had the benefit of practicing in various settings, learning from other highly skilled clinicians and holding titles ranging from staff physical therapist to Regional Rehabilitation Director. As a director, she created evidence-based practice protocols and guidelines in collaboration with physicians utilizing a compressive approach to care. She is dedicated learner and teacher often traveling to take, teach or attend classes and conferences as a member of various professional organizations. Creating a private practice and studio that truly utilizes the whole-body approach to bridge the gap in traditional healthcare models has been a lifelong aspiration.
She specializes in pelvic health and rehabilitation, vestibular rehabilitation, balance training, core stabilization, pain management and holistic patient centered care. She has a special interest in working with underserved populations including teens and adults with Scoliosis, Spina Bifida, Complex mixed neurological and orthopedic diagnosis. She believes in empowering her clients and patients with the skills and knowledge to better understand their bodies who at times present with multiple issues that are often related. She is passionate about helping her patient and client with making educated choices to improve their overall health. She believes that everybody can safely improve overall health, longevity and utilizing the principles and work of Joseph Pilates and other pioneers that focus on body awareness and breath-work.

Practice Name

Cor Physical Therapy and Pilates Studio

Practice Website

Practice Description

All of our physical therapy sessions are one on one, private and personalized care. We treat any and all physical therapy issues, but also specialize in Pelvic Health and Vestibular Physical Therapy. Our clinic takes a more holistic approach than traditional outpatient physical therapy clinics through treating the body as a whole (and incorporating Pilates equipment into personalized care!)
